EASY VEGETARIAN POT PIE RECIPE - HOW TO MAKE VEGETARIAN ...



Easy Vegetarian Pot Pie Recipe - How to Make Vegetarian ... image

You won't miss the meat in this vegetarian pot pie! It's filled with hearty ingredients, like beans and mushrooms, and is topped with flaky puff pastry.

Provided by THEPIONEERWOMAN.COM

Categories     weeknight meals    winter    comfort food    dinner    main dish

Total Time 1 hours

Prep Time 30 minutes

Cook Time 0S

Yield 4-5 servings

Number Of Ingredients 16

5 tbsp.

butter, divided

12 oz.

button mushrooms, quartered

2

cloves garlic, chopped

1 tsp.

fresh thyme leaves

2

carrots, chopped

1

yellow onion, chopped

3

celery stalks, chopped

1/2 tsp.

salt, plus more to taste

1/2 tsp.

ground black pepper, plus more to taste

3 tbsp.

all-purpose flour

2 1/2 c.

vegetable broth

1/2 c.

+ 1 tablespoon heavy cream, divided

1

15 oz. can white beans, drained and rinsed

1 c.

frozen peas

1/2 c.

freshly grated parmesan cheese, plus more for topping

1

sheet puff pastry, from 1, 17oz package, thawed

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ees. Melt 2 tablespoons of butter in a 10-inch cast-iron skillet over medium-high heat. Add the mushrooms and let sit for 3 minutes, without stirring. Reduce the heat to medium and add the garlic and thyme. Let cook 2 more minutes, stirring frequently, until the mushrooms are tender. Remove to a plate and set aside. Return the skillet to medium heat and add the remaining 3 tablespoons of butter. Once melted, add the carrots, onion, celery and salt and pepper. Let cook 7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until slightly tender. Add the flour and stir well to combine. Cook 2 more minutes. Add the vegetable stock and increase the heat to medium-high. Cook 5-7 minutes, stirring frequently, until the mixture reaches a low boil and thickens. Pour in ½ cup of heavy cream, white beans, ½ cup of grated parmesan cheese and the reserved mushrooms. Stir well to combine, season with salt and pepper, if desired, and remove from the heat. Carefully transfer the skillet to a sheet tray lined with foil. Unfold the puff pastry and carefully place it in the center of the skillet over top of the pot pie filling (draping over the edges of the skillet). Brush the pastry all over with the remaining 1 tablespoon of heavy cream. Sprinkle with extra parmesan cheese, thyme leaves and black pepper. Bake for 20-25 minutes until the top crust is golden brown and the mixture is bubbly.  Let rest 5 minutes, then scoop into bowls and serve.

QUICK AND EASY VEGETABLE POTPIE R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T



Quick and Easy Vegetable Potpie Recipe: How to Make It image

This meatless Monday superstar comes together quickly and is inexpensive as well. My 4-year-old always asks for seconds! You can substitute any canned or frozen beans for the canned lentils in this easy vegetable potpie. We also like using frozen edamame. —Maggie Torsney-Weir, Los Angeles, California

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Total Time 60 minutes

Prep Time 30 minutes

Cook Time 30 minutes

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 tablespoons butter
3 cups frozen mixed vegetables, thawed
1 can (15 ounces) lentils, drained
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 cup vegetable or chicken broth
1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
1 teaspoon quatre epices (French four spice)
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 sheet refrigerated pie crust
1 tablespoon olive oil
1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375°. In a large skillet, melt butter over medium heat. Add vegetables and lentils; cook and stir until heated through, 3-5 minutes. Stir in flour until blended; gradually whisk in broth. Bring to a boil, stirring constantly; cook and stir until thickened, 1-2 minutes. Stir in mustard, quatre epices and salt., Transfer to a greased 9-in. pie plate. Place pie crust over filling. Trim; cut slits in top. Brush with oil; sprinkle with Parmesan. Bake until golden brown, 30-35 minutes. Cool 5 minutes before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 356 calories, FatContent 17g fat (7g saturated fat), CholesterolContent 20mg cholesterol, SodiumContent 705mg sodium, CarbohydrateContent 41g carbohydrate (5g sugars, FiberContent 9g fiber), ProteinContent 10g protein.
